What I Look for Before Buying
Before I buy this syrup, I pay attention to a few things:
- Flavor profile: I want a rich vanilla taste that is not too artificial or overly sweet.
- Size: I check the bottle size to make sure it fits my usage, whether for daily coffee or occasional drinks.
- Compatibility: I make sure it works well in both hot and cold beverages.
- Ingredients: I review the label if I care about sweetness level, additives, or dietary preferences.
- Value for money: I compare the price with how many drinks I can make from one bottle.
